The Big Book of Barry Ween, Boy Genius


Judd Winick - 2009
    What does a ten-year-old boy do with a 350 I.Q.? Anything he wants! Cranky, egotistical, arrogant, and foul-mouthed, Barry in general wants to conduct his experiments and be left alone, but it never seems to work out. Hurdles that Barry must outmaneuver range from time warps, to art thieves, to inter-dimensional warfare with gorillas, to accidentally turning his best friend into a dinosaur! This massive volume collects all three BARRY WEEN mini-series—12 issues in all—for a complete compilation of the hit series, THE ADVENTURES OF BARRY WEEN, BOY GENIUS.

Dreadstar: The Beginning


Jim Starlin - 2010
    These gorgeous, painted pages originally appeared in Epic from 1979 to 1982, and introduced audiences to Vance Dreadstar and the other characters whose saga would be continued in the Dreadstar series.
